The cheapest way to get from Carlow to Kells is to train and bus which costs €17 - €26 and takes 3h 20m.
The fastest way to get from Carlow to Kells is to drive which takes 1h 40m and costs €19 - €29.
No, there is no direct bus from Carlow station to Kells. However, there are services departing from Carlow Bus Station and arriving at Kells via Dublin Busáras.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 33m.
The distance between Carlow and Kells is 156 km. The road distance is 117.6 km.
The best way to get from Carlow to Kells without a car is to train and bus which takes 3h 20m and costs €17 - €26.
It takes approximately 3h 20m to get from Carlow to Kells, including transfers.
Carlow to Kells bus services, operated by J.J.Kavanagh & Sons, depart from Carlow Bus Station.
Carlow to Kells bus services, operated by J.J.Kavanagh & Sons, arrive at Eden Quay station.
Yes, the driving distance between Carlow to Kells is 118 km. It takes approximately 1h 40m to drive from Carlow to Kells.
